Hi Norman, I've taken my advice from a tutorial by Daniel Robbins, published by IBM.
He advises enabling the following under network options: <*> Packet socket [*] Network packet filtering (replaces ipchains) <*> Unix domain sockets [*] TCP/IP networking [*] IP: advanced router [*] IP: policy routing [*] IP: use netfilter MARK value as routing key [*] IP: fast network address translation [*] IP: use TOP value as routing key Under "IP: Netfilter configuration ---->" menu, enable every option in order to ger full netfilter functionality.This way you can do some experimentation without having to recompile. He also advises NOT enabling explicit congestion notification. [ ] IP: TCP Explicit Congestion Notification support ________________________________________________________ Works for me!
